Quote from: idahofisherman on December 28, 2010, 01:48:08 AM
The scheduling seems to be querky.

idahofisherman,

Quirky is an understatement--but it's also by design.  For information on how task scheduling actually works, I suggest you read this BOINC FAQ article and the BOINC WIKI detailed description.  You'll see there's a lot more going on than just changing every 60 minutes.  And not all projects' types of work units play well together under BOINC's Scheduling Policy.  But if you still think something is broken, the BOINC message board is the appropriate place to post your concerns ;)

Wish List / Notices options
December 25, 2010, 06:50:16 PM
I call this a low priority feature request rather than a bug:

On Settings>Notices if Hide notice after & Show alert every are deselected, the data entry textboxes disappear.  When the options are selected again, the numbers have returned to default values (60 days & 30 minutes).  Request instead that the textboxes remain visible/grayed out, and retain the values entered.  (Two more keys for the Registry? :) )
